Our process, step by step
Before each forecast, we run a site-specific checklist: map hazards, stage salt, and assign crews to sections. Coordinators monitor live radar and update routes hourly.
When flakes start, operators move with pre-set run cards. Edge guards stay conservative near landscaping to avoid damage. Hand crews fan out to walkways and align with plows so cars move freely.
During long events, we cycle priority areas on rotating cadence. Melt is refreshed where wind tunnels trigger refreeze. We log photos every round so you see exactly where we focused.
After the storm, we run a final sweep to push back piles, melt stragglers, and deliver a recap with timestamps and follow-up plan. If wind will drift, we set a proactive touch to block black ice.

Maintenance and prevention
Snow is not the only threat. We anti-ice before storms to prevent ice. After a sweep, we treat shadow lines where shade hold cold.
We inspect downspouts for ice dams and free them so meltwater moves away from walkways. We place salt bins in problem spots for quick touch-ups during overnight events.
Our brine ratios match pavement typepaversso traction holds without staining. We note what we apply so you understand costs clearly.
